What is a Termination Cancellation Letter?

The Termination Cancellation Letter is used when parties who have initiated a contract termination process decide to reverse this decision and continue their original agreement. This document type is particularly important in Qatar's business environment, where formal documentation of such decisions is crucial for legal compliance and clarity. It needs to reference the original contract and termination notice, specify the effective date of cancellation, and clearly state the terms of reinstatement. The letter must comply with Qatar's legal requirements, including Labor Law No. 14 of 2004 and the Civil Code, and should be prepared in both Arabic and English when necessary. This document is commonly used in employment situations, business partnerships, and service contracts where parties wish to maintain their original contractual relationship after reconsidering a termination decision.

Frequently Asked Questions

Is a termination cancellation letter legally binding in Qatar under Labor Law No. 14 of 2004?

Yes, a properly executed termination cancellation letter is legally binding in Qatar when it complies with Labor Law No. 14 of 2004 and the Civil Code. The document must reference the original contract and termination notice, be signed by both parties, and clearly state the intention to reverse the termination. Qatar's formal documentation requirements make this letter essential for legal protection and compliance.

Can my employer reject my termination cancellation request under Qatar labor law?

Yes, your employer can reject a termination cancellation request as it requires mutual agreement from both parties under Qatar law. The employer has no legal obligation to reverse a valid termination notice once issued. However, if both parties agree to cancel the termination, the letter becomes binding and restores the original contractual relationship.

How long does it take to prepare a termination cancellation letter in Qatar?

A basic termination cancellation letter can typically be prepared within 1-2 business days using a proper template. However, negotiating terms and obtaining mutual agreement from both parties may take several days to weeks depending on the complexity. Time-sensitive situations require immediate action as termination notices have specific deadlines under Qatar Labor Law No. 14 of 2004.

Does a termination cancellation letter affect my end-of-service benefits in Qatar?

A properly executed termination cancellation letter restores your original employment contract, preserving your continuous service record and end-of-service benefit calculations under Qatar Labor Law No. 14 of 2004. The cancellation essentially nullifies the termination as if it never occurred. Your benefits continue to accrue based on your total uninterrupted service period.

Can I use a termination cancellation letter if my employment contract has already ended in Qatar?

No, a termination cancellation letter cannot reverse a contract that has already been fully executed and ended under Qatar law. The letter must be signed and agreed upon before the termination becomes effective. Once employment has actually ceased and final settlements are made, you would need a new employment contract rather than a cancellation letter.

Common mistakes when drafting termination cancellation letters in Qatar include which errors?

Common mistakes include failing to reference the original termination notice date and details, not obtaining signatures from both parties, and missing deadline requirements under Qatar Labor Law No. 14 of 2004. Other errors include vague language about terms restoration, incomplete contact information, and not addressing any changes to working conditions or salary that may have occurred during the termination period.

How does a termination cancellation letter differ from a contract amendment in Qatar?

A termination cancellation letter specifically reverses a previously issued termination notice and restores the original contract terms, while a contract amendment modifies existing terms without addressing termination. The cancellation letter is reactionary to a termination situation, whereas amendments proactively change contract conditions. Under Qatar law, both serve different purposes and have distinct legal implications for employment relationships.

About the Termination Cancellation Letter

A Termination Cancellation Letter is a formal legal document that reverses a previously issued termination notice, allowing parties to continue their original contractual relationship. In Qatar's highly regulated business environment, this document serves as essential legal protection when you need to restore agreements that were set for termination.

When do you need this document?

You need a Termination Cancellation Letter when circumstances change after issuing a termination notice. Common situations include employment disputes that are resolved through negotiation, service contracts where performance issues are addressed, or business partnerships where initial concerns are satisfactorily resolved. The document is particularly important when the termination notice has been formally served but the actual termination date has not yet occurred. This allows you to maintain business continuity while ensuring all parties understand that the original agreement remains in effect. In Qatar's business culture, formal documentation of such decisions demonstrates professionalism and helps prevent future disputes about contractual status.

Key legal considerations

Several critical legal elements must be addressed when drafting your Termination Cancellation Letter. You must clearly reference the original contract and the specific termination notice being cancelled, including dates and parties involved. The cancellation statement should be unambiguous and specify the effective date from which the termination is void. All parties must agree to the cancellation, and this mutual consent should be documented. Consider including any modified terms or conditions that address the original reasons for termination. You should also specify whether any actions taken during the termination notice period need to be reversed or adjusted. The letter should clarify the status of any benefits, payments, or obligations that may have been affected by the original termination notice.

Legal requirements in Qatar

Under Qatar Labor Law No. 14 of 2004, employment-related termination cancellations must follow specific procedural requirements and notice periods. The Qatar Civil Code governs general contractual relationships and provides the legal framework for contract modification and cancellation reversals. Your document must comply with formal notice requirements under the Civil and Commercial Procedure Law, which may require specific delivery methods or acknowledgment procedures. Recent amendments under Law No. 7 of 2019 have strengthened worker protections and may affect how employment termination cancellations are processed. For commercial relationships, the Commercial Companies Law may impose additional requirements if corporate entities are involved. The document should be prepared in Arabic for official purposes, with English translations acceptable for international business contexts. Ensure proper legal naming, addresses, and signature requirements are met according to Qatar's legal standards for binding contractual modifications.
